Self-reporting Questionnaires

There are a number of questionnaire's that we might use as a part of our assessment including the following;

SNAP IV

The SNAP-IV rating scale is a tool used to assess symptoms of att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der, ADHD) in young people. It is a widely used and well-validated measure that can help clinicians and researchers evaluate the presence and severity of ADHD symptoms.

Parents and teachers and adolescents may all be approached to complete the SNAP IV as a part of our assessment
